There are no entry requirements for this qualification.

While there are no formal course entry requirements, it is recommended that students be able to read, write, have numeracy skills and communicate in English to at least Australian Core Skills Framework (ACSF) level three (3).

All prospective students are required to complete prior to enrolment a Language, Literacy, Numeracy and Digital (LLND) Assessment. This ensures a student’s skills and competencies including their language, literacy and numeracy proficiency and digital literacy are suitable for the training product in which they would like to enrol in. The successful achievement of this qualification requires the completion of fifteen (15) units of competency, made up of six (6) core units and nine (9) elective units, consisting of: 

  • One (1) unit from Group A 
  • Six (6) units from Group B 
  • Two (2) units from Group B, Group C, elsewhere in the SIT Training Package, or any other current Training Package or accredited course. 

The selection of electives must be guided by the job outcome sought, local industry requirements and the complexity of skills appropriate to the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F) level of this qualification.

The code and title of each unit are provided as well as an indication of pre-requisite requirements. Pre-requisite unit(s) must be assessed before assessment of any unit of competency with any of the following symbols.

* Pre-requisite unit required: SITXFSA005 Use hygienic practices for food safety

^ Pre-requisite units required: SITHFAB021 Provide responsible service of alcohol and SITXFSA005 Use hygienic practices for food safety

# Pre-requisite units required: SITXFSA005 Use hygienic practices for food safety, SITHFAB021 Provide responsible service of alcohol and SITHFAB023 Operate a bar

Core Units:

  • SITHIND006 Source and use information on the hospitality industry
  • SITHIND008 Work effectively in hospitality service
  • SITXCCS014 Provide service to customers
  • SITXCOM007 Show social and cultural sensitivity
  • SITXHRM007 Coach others in job skills
  • SITXWHS005 Participate in safe work practice

Elective Units (Group A – Hygiene):

  • SITXFSA005 Use hygienic practices for food safety

Elective Units (Group B – Hospitality):

  • SITHFAB025 Prepare and serve espresso coffee*
  • SITHFAB021 Provide responsible service of alcohol
  • SITHFAB024 Prepare and serve non-alcoholic beverages*
  • SITHCCC024 Prepare and present simple dishes*
  • SITHCCC025 Prepare and present sandwiches*
  • SITHFAB027 Serve food and beverage*
  • SITHCCC028 Prepare appetisers and salads*
  • SITXCCS012 Provide lost and found services
  • SITXFSA006 Participate in safe food handling practices
  • SITHFAB023 Operate a bar^
  • SITHFAB030 Prepare and serve cocktails#

Elective Units (Group C – General):

  • BSBSUS211 Participate in sustainable work practices
  • BSBCMM211 Apply communication skills
  • SITXFIN007 Process financial transactions

To achieve this qualification, the student must have completed at leastthirty-six (36) service shifts conducted within a hospitality outlet, or simulated environment. The RTO is responsible for placement of all students.
